Chapter 26: The Final Challenge

As the National Championship approached its end, Sports Academy Harmonia prepared to face their toughest challenge yet: Flaming Fury College, a team known for their aggression and individual skill.

"This is our last challenge before the finals. Let's give it our all and show everything we've learned so far," Kaya said, motivating her teammates.

The game started with overwhelming intensity, both teams fiercely contesting every inch of the field.

"Let's stay strong in defense and not give them any room to break through," Laura instructed, guiding the defense.

The players of Sports Academy Harmonia faced quick dribbles and powerful shots from the opponent, but they didn't back down.

"We can't let them intimidate us. Let's show our resilience," Gabi said, keeping her composure.

Kaya skillfully dribbled past opposing players, creating scoring opportunities for her team.

"Kaya, your agility is incredible. Keep it up!" Isabela praised.

The match continued intensely, both teams showcasing determination and skill.

"Let's keep pressing and find the right moment to attack," Sofia directed, staying focused.

In the end, Flaming Fury College scored a goal, taking the lead. But the players of Sports Academy Harmonia didn't give up.

"We won't give in. We'll fight until the last minute," Kaya affirmed, with determination.

During the second half, Sports Academy Harmonia intensified their pressure, creating numerous scoring chances.

"Let's show them what we're capable of," Laura said, leading the attack.

In a pivotal moment, Sofia delivered a precise pass to Kaya, who finished with a powerful shot, equalizing the game.

"That's it, Kaya! You're our soccer queen!" Gabi exclaimed, celebrating the play.

The match ended in a draw, and both teams left the field exhausted but satisfied with the effort they put in.

As the National Championship drew to a close, the players of Sports Academy Harmonia reflected on their journey so far.

"We've made great progress and faced incredible teams. We're ready for the finals," Kaya said, looking at her teammates with determination.
